[PATCH] maps.2: fd for a file mapping must be opened for reading

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



Here is no difference between MAP_SHARED and MAP_PRIVATE.

do_mmap_pgoff()
	switch (flags & MAP_TYPE) {
	case MAP_SHARED:
	...
	/* fall through */
	case MAP_PRIVATE:
		if (!(file->f_mode & FMODE_READ))
			return -EACCES;
